What you’ll be doing:
- Manage, lead, train and motivate a team to deliver delight.
- Oversee the smooth running of our food & beverage operations, ensure the preparation for service, as well as overseeing service and ensuring the after-service duties are appropriately carried out and managed.
- Maximise sales whilst driving profitable growth with care and flair.
- Lead and manage all aspects of stock control, implementing company policies to ensure efficient ordering, accurate deliveries, and thorough stock-taking practices.
- Ensure all team members follow specified standards for food and drink service to maintain consistency, and achieve theoretical stock targets.
- Deliver KPIs and annual profit targets in our food & beverage operations through smart budget planning, an eye for commercial opportunities and leadership skills that motivate your teams to deliver.
- Take full ownership of all food & beverage elements for events, working closely with the events team to ensure every menu is costed accurately and aligns with our standards.
- Oversee on-the-day execution to deliver a seamless and memorable guest experience.
- Support the delivery of our outstanding guest experience by providing strong leadership and motivation to permanent and seasonal team.
- Be responsible for health and safety, ensuring the business meets its statutory obligations and that all team members receive relevant training.
